[問題] 初學者問題 while(不是條件)

看板C_and_CPP作者 (鼠它)時間11年前 (2013/03/26 01:07), 編輯推噓0(002)
留言2則, 2人參與, 最新討論串1/1
開發平台(Platform): (Ex: VC++, GCC, Linux, ...) dev c 問題(Question): 各位好,小弟初學C程式,今天碰到一個while迴圈的寫法,不是很瞭解他的用法 通常我看到的while(),括號裡都是一個判斷條件,ex: a>5 可是我碰到別人寫的,括號裡只是一個值,沒有看到 > < == != 這些 ex: while(a) 為什麼這樣迴圈還能跑呢? 初學觀念尚未清晰,煩請賜教,感恩!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 114.38.61.102

03/26 01:09, , 1F
非零即為 TRUE
03/26 01:09, 1F

03/26 01:19, , 2F
恍然大悟!感謝你!
03/26 01:19, 2F
文章代碼(AID): #1HK8HPSy (C_and_CPP)